THIS IS ANTARCTICA!!!













Holy Guacamole, this is crazy, we are stuck in the middle of a herbie, which is a hurricane with snow!! The temps are not absolutly crazy low but are low enough, about -25 below, but the winds are up to about 100-130mph!!!!!!! Just nuts I tell ya, I feel like a kid in the first snow storm of the year but the wind makes it off the rocker!! I have seen some good stuff here but this takes the cake. I really just can't describe how amazing this is!! This for me is the closest I will ever be able to come to know what it was like for Shackelton, Ross and the many other hardened travelers of the old!!! The fact that I am wearing Mountain Hardwear gear and modern day insulation makes it a lot easier to bear, but nonetheless, it is a treat to experience this level of weather, which is truly found only on one place on the planet, Antarctica!!!!!!!
